Network Health is seeking a SQL Developer - Data warehouse This individual is part of a team dedicated to supporting Network Health's Enterprise Data Warehouse. This individual will perform development, analysis, testing, debugging, documentation, and implementation of interfaces and reports to support the Enterprise Data Warehouse and related applications. They will consult with other technical resources and key departmental users on solutions and best practices. They will monitor performance and effectiveness of the data warehouse and recommend changes as appropriate.
